The gini coefficient for the distribution of coins over addresses. Exchange addresses, smart contract addresses, and other special asset-specific addresses (e.g. team fund addresses) are excluded for the computation of the gini.
This is the Point-in-Time (PiT) variant of Gini Coefficient. PiT metrics are strictly append-only and their history is immutable. The historic data does not necessarily reflect the best current knowledge, but the information at the time when a data point was first computed. PiT metrics are ideal candidates for applications in model backtesting and related quantitative purposes. Read our article on PiT metrics for more information.
